which of the following is the correct equation for the line passing through the point (-2,1) and having slope m=1/2
mina [271]

Answer:

y=1/2x+2

Step-by-step explanation:

m=1/2

y=mx+b

1=1/2*-2+b

1=-1+b

b=2

y=1/2x+b
